    Overview

    Gadolinium is the chemical element with the symbol Gd and atomic number 64. It belongs to the Lanthanide group and is located in period 6 of the periodic table. It exists as a solid under standard conditions.

    Key Facts

    Fun Fact #1

    Named after scientist Johan Gadolin

    Fun Fact #2

    Has high neutron absorption capacity

    Common Uses

    • MRI contrast agents
    • Nuclear reactors
    • Memory devices
